Setup and Installation
Note: This is not a DIY system. Professional installation by a qualified HVAC technician is required to ensure proper function, safety, and warranty validity. The condenser comes pre-charged with refrigerant.
Pre-Installation Checks:
- Ensure the installation location for both indoor and outdoor units meets clearance requirements for proper airflow and maintenance access.
- Verify that the electrical supply matches the unit's requirements (230V for this model). A dedicated power source is recommended.
- Confirm the integrity of the pre-charged line set and all included accessories.
Installation Overview (for Professional Reference):
- Mount the indoor unit securely on the wall, ensuring proper drainage slope.
- Position the outdoor condenser unit on a stable, level surface, away from obstructions.
- Connect the insulated copper line set between the indoor and outdoor units. Ensure proper flaring and torque.
- Connect the communication cable and drainage extension.
- Evacuate the system using a vacuum pump to remove air and moisture from the refrigerant lines.
- Open the valves on the outdoor unit to release the pre-charged refrigerant into the system.
- Connect the unit to the dedicated electrical circuit.
- Perform a leak check and test run to ensure proper operation.

Operating Instructions
Your OLMO Mini Split system offers various modes and features for optimal comfort. All functions are controlled via the included remote control.

Figure 5: Remote Control for the OLMO Mini Split System.
Basic Operation:
- Power On/Off: Press the ON/OFF button to start or stop the unit.
- Mode Selection: Press the MODE button to cycle through available modes:
- Cool: For cooling the room.
- Heat: For heating the room (heat pump function).
- Dry (Dehumidify): To reduce humidity.
- Fan: Circulates air without heating or cooling.
- Auto: Automatically selects mode based on room temperature.
- Temperature Adjustment: Use the TEMP ▲/▼ buttons to set your desired temperature.
- Fan Speed: Press the FAN button to adjust fan speed (Auto, Low, Medium, High).
- Louver Auto Swing: Activates automatic vertical louver movement for even air distribution.
Advanced Features:
- Comfortable Sleep Mode: Adjusts temperature automatically during sleep for energy efficiency and comfort.
- Timer Function: Set the unit to turn on or off automatically at a specified time.
- Self-Diagnosis: The unit can perform self-diagnosis and display error codes on the LED display.
- Intelligent Pre-heating: In heating mode, the unit pre-heats before blowing air to prevent cold drafts.
- Auto Restart Function: The unit automatically restarts with previous settings after a power outage.
- LED Display: Provides real-time temperature and status information.

Maintenance
Regular maintenance ensures optimal performance and longevity of your OLMO Mini Split system. Always disconnect power before performing maintenance.
Air Filter Cleaning:
- The indoor unit features washable filters.
- Open the front panel of the indoor unit.
- Remove the air filters.
- Clean the filters with a vacuum cleaner or wash them with lukewarm water and a mild detergent.
- Allow filters to dry completely before reinserting them.
- Clean filters every two weeks or more frequently depending on usage and air quality.
Outdoor Unit Maintenance:
- Keep the area around the outdoor unit clear of debris, leaves, and snow.
- Periodically clean the outdoor coil with a soft brush or vacuum cleaner to remove dirt and dust.
- Ensure the drainage outlet is not blocked.
- For detailed cleaning and professional checks, it is recommended to schedule annual maintenance with a qualified technician.
Troubleshooting
Before contacting technical support, please refer to the following common issues and solutions:
| Problem | Possible Cause | Solution |
|---|---|---|
| Unit does not turn on. | No power supply; Remote control batteries dead. | Check circuit breaker; Replace remote control batteries. |
| Insufficient cooling/heating. | Dirty air filters; Obstruction to airflow; Incorrect mode setting; Low refrigerant. | Clean air filters; Remove obstructions; Select correct mode; Contact professional for refrigerant check. |
| Unusual noise. | Loose parts; Fan obstruction; Unit not level. | Check for loose parts; Clear fan area; Ensure unit is level. If noise persists, contact support. |
| Water leakage from indoor unit. | Clogged drain pipe; Improper installation. | Clear drain pipe; Contact professional for inspection. |
Specifications
Detailed technical specifications for the OLMO 9,000 BTU 230V Mini Split System:
| Feature | Detail |
|---|---|
| Brand Name | OLMO |
| Model Info | Alpic |
| Item Model Number | OS-EL09ALP230V |
| Product Dimensions | 48 x 40 x 40 inches (Shipping) |
| Cooling Capacity | 9,000 BTU |
| Heating Capacity | Heat Pump Functionality |
| Voltage | 230 Volts |
| Seasonal Energy Efficiency Ratio (SEER) | 16.5 |
| Heating Seasonal Performance Factor (HSPF) | 9.4 |
| Installation Type | Split System |
| Refrigerant | R 410A |
| Special Features | LED Display, Defrost, Heating, Inverter Technology, Louver Auto Swing, Remote Included, Comfortable Sleep Mode, Multiple Fan Speeds, Timer, Self Diagnosis, Intelligent Pre-heating, Auto Restart Function |
| Color | White |
| Power Source | Corded Electric |
